Did You Know: Your Existing Policies May Not Cover Your RV.

One of the most common mistakes RV owners make is insuring their RV on a standard auto policy or assuming their homeowners policy fills the gap. Neither fully covers your RV. Standard auto policies typically do not include comprehensive coverage for personal belongings inside your motorhome or travel trailer. Standard homeowners policies have strict limitations on off-premises coverage and often require a sizable deductible before coverage applies to items stored away from home.

A dedicated RV insurance policy fills these gaps completely, protecting your vehicle, your belongings, and your liability whether you're on the road or parked at a campsite in Florida.

Florida RV Insurance Requirements

Insurance requirements for RVs in Florida depend on whether your rig is motorized or towed. Here's what Florida law requires — and what we strongly recommend beyond the minimum.

Motorized RVs (Class A, B & C)

Required by Florida Law

Florida law treats motorhomes as motor vehicles. Any motorized RV operated on Florida public roads must carry the following minimum coverage:

  • Personal Injury Protection (PIP) — minimum $10,000: Covers your medical expenses after an accident regardless of fault, as part of Florida's no-fault insurance system.
  • Property Damage Liability (PDL) — minimum $10,000: Covers damage you cause to another person's property in an at-fault accident.

Given the size and potential damage a motorhome can cause, carrying limits well above the state minimum is strongly advisable. These minimums are widely considered inadequate for a serious accident involving a large motorized vehicle.

Travel Trailers & Fifth Wheels

No Separate Policy Required by FL Law

Travel trailers, fifth wheels, and other non-motorized towed RVs are not driven independently. Florida law does not require a separate insurance policy for the trailer itself — liability from the towing vehicle's auto policy extends to the trailer while being towed.

However — the towing vehicle's policy only covers liability to others. It does not cover physical damage to the trailer itself, its contents, or liability when your trailer is parked and being used as a residence. A dedicated RV policy is strongly recommended.

If your travel trailer is financed, your lender will typically require comprehensive and collision coverage regardless of Florida's minimum requirements.

What a Dedicated RV Policy Covers

A specialized RV or motorhome policy provides protections that standard auto and homeowners policies do not. Here's what each coverage type provides in plain language.

Comprehensive & Collision

Comprehensive protects against non-collision losses — theft, vandalism, fire, hurricane and storm damage, hail, and animal impacts. Florida's severe weather makes this especially important. Collision covers damage when your RV collides with another vehicle or object. Required by most lenders for financed RVs.

Vacation & Campsite Liability

A standard auto policy provides liability while driving — but typically not when your RV is parked and used as a temporary residence. This coverage protects you if a guest is injured at your campsite, or if an incident at your parked RV causes damage to a neighboring site. Essential for any Florida RVer who uses their rig as a residence.

Personal Effects Coverage

Covers personal belongings inside your RV — clothing, electronics, kitchenware, outdoor gear, and other items. Standard auto policies do not cover these belongings. Particularly important for full-time RVers or those who travel with valuable equipment.

Emergency Expense Coverage

If your motorhome is damaged while you're on the road and becomes uninhabitable, this coverage pays for temporary housing or travel expenses to get you home. We'll also pay to transport your damaged motorhome to your home, a repair center, or a storage facility.

Uninsured / Underinsured Motorist

Florida has one of the highest rates of uninsured drivers in the country. This coverage protects you if you're hit by a driver who has no insurance or insufficient coverage to pay for your damages or injuries — including while operating your motorhome.

Roadside Assistance

RV breakdowns can be complex and expensive to resolve. Roadside assistance covers towing to the nearest qualified repair facility, jump starts, flat tire service, fuel delivery, and lockout service — available 24/7 wherever Florida's roads take you.

Total Loss Replacement

An optional coverage that pays for the cost of a new replacement RV of the same make and model if yours is totaled and the vehicle is within a qualifying model year — rather than just the depreciated actual cash value. Ask your agent about availability for your specific rig.

All Rigs. All Routes. All of Florida.

Whether you own a luxury Class A diesel pusher or a compact pop-up camper, we'll find the right policy for your rig and the way you use it.

Class A Motorhomes

The largest and most luxurious motorhomes, typically 26 to 45 feet. Built on a commercial bus or truck chassis, these require dedicated insurance and must meet Florida's minimum coverage requirements as a motorized vehicle.

Class B Motorhomes (Campervans)

Built on a standard van chassis, the most compact of the motorhome classes. More maneuverable and fuel-efficient, but still classified as a motorized vehicle under Florida law and must carry the required minimum coverage.

Class C Motorhomes

Built on a truck or van chassis with a distinctive over-cab sleeping area. A popular choice for Florida families. Like Class A and B, they require the state minimum PIP and PDL coverage under Florida law.

Travel Trailers

Towed by a truck or SUV, travel trailers don't require a separate policy under Florida law, but the towing vehicle's coverage won't protect the trailer itself from physical damage or theft. A dedicated policy is strongly recommended.

Fifth-Wheel Trailers

Larger towed trailers that connect via a special hitch in a pickup truck bed. Like travel trailers, they're not required to carry separate insurance in Florida, but dedicated coverage is essential to protect your investment and campsite liability.

Pop-Up Campers & Toy Haulers

Lightweight and easy to tow, pop-up campers and toy haulers are popular with Florida weekend adventurers. While not required to carry separate insurance in Florida, a dedicated policy protects your gear and your campsite liability exposure.
